Biography

Oyelami Adéyẹmí Anthony is a priest of the Catholic Diocese of Ekiti. He started his academic journey through St. Gregory Catholic Primary school Ikare Akoko, Annunciation School Ikere Ekiti and eventually through the seminary of St. Peter and Paul an affiliate of the University of Ibadan and Pontifical Urbananian University Rome where he bagged Bachelor degree in both Philosophy and Theology.
He proceeded in 2016 to University of Ilorin where he bagged his Master degree in comparative Religious Studies and currently running his Ph.D program in the same University. After teaching for Eighteen years with the Ekiti State teaching service commission, he joined the University community in 2021.
He is currently with the department of Religious Studies in the Faculty of Arts, Federal University Oye-Ekiti.
